Members of the ADAM family are cell surface proteins with a unique structure possessing both potential adhesion and protease domains. This gene encodes and ADAM family member that cleaves many proteins including TNF-alpha and E-cadherin. Alternate splicing results in multiple transcript variants encoding different proteins that may undergo similar processing. [provided by RefSeq, Feb 2016]

Alexa Fluor™ 555 (AF555, Alexa 555) has an excitation peak at 555 nm and an emission peak at 565 nm, and is spectrally similar to Cy®3 (GE Healthcare), TRITC, iFluor® 555 (ATT Bioquest) and iFluor® 560 (ATT Bioquest).
